значок intellij над файлами проекта - PullRequest
28 голосов
/ 28 апреля 2010

intellij разместил то, что похоже на отсутствие признаков входа в мои java-файлы (красные кружки с линией через), которые я искал, но не могу найти почему? Кто-нибудь знает, пожалуйста.

Это проект Maven, если это имеет значение

Ответы [ 3 ]

41 голосов
/ 28 апреля 2010

Это означает, что эти файлы не являются частью настроек проекта. Как вы создали этот проект?

Я не уверен, какую версию IntelliJ вы используете - я использую 9.0.1. Я бы рекомендовал открыть структуру проекта (значок справа от «гаечного ключа» или Ctrl + Alt + Shift + S), нажать «Модули» и указать каталог, в котором находятся файлы .java, в качестве исходного каталога ( изменится на синий цвет).

5 голосов
/ 16 июля 2013

Для тех, у кого эта проблема с Android Studio. Попробуйте следующее:

1) Перейдите к настройкам вашего проекта

2) Зайдите в Модули -> и на вкладке опции модуля выберите «Источники» - Должна быть опция «Добавить корень содержимого», а под ней - синяя, зеленая и красная вкладки для исходных папок, тестовых исходных папок и исключенных папок соответственно.

3) Справа щелкните правой кнопкой мыши папку исходного кода Java, которую вы хотите добавить, и выберите, чтобы добавить ее в источник или в тесты (в зависимости от того, какие файлы вы добавляете).

4) Добавленные файлы теперь должны отображаться с синим кружком с буквой c в центре на левой панели окна проекта.

0 голосов
/ 11 декабря 2013

Для проектов Maven:

В моем случае мне пришлось импортировать проект через Maven. Некоторые модули отсутствовали (они не были указаны в корневом разделе), поэтому добавление их в виде проектов maven решило проблему.

щелкните значок «плюс» в правом меню Maven, а затем добавьте проект. Это автоматически импортировало все источники / структуру.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...